Digital Innovation & Sustainability for Advanced Manufacturing
About
MECB, based in Malta, provides applied engineering, digital and sustainability expertise supporting smart, resource-efficient and energy-efficient manufacturing. MECB operates at the intersection of advanced manufacturing and digital transformation, contributing to solutions aligned with Twin Transition and Industry 5.0 objectives.
MECB applies systematic design and engineering methods — including Design-for-Manufacturing and Assembly (DfMA) and other Design-for-X approaches, supported by digital enablers such as AI-based decision support, knowledge models and ontologies to improve technical feasibility, efficiency and sustainability across product and system lifecycles.
MECB also develops digital tools for capacity building and knowledge transfer, including AR-based training and visualisation resources and e-learning environments, supporting skills development, best-practice exchange and uptake of innovative solutions by industrial and public stakeholders.
With experience in collaborative EU projects, MECB contributes to stakeholder engagement, exploitation and impact activities, supporting the adoption and long-term value of project results.
